1

You will enjoy the beauty of Athens Riviera which is the coastal area in the southern suburbs of Athens, from Piraeus to the most southern point of Attica region, Cape Sounio. You ll see the endless coast which is full of little gulfs, marinas, and natural beauty. It will take us almost 50min. from your pick up point (hotel or Port of Piraeus), until we reach our first destination, the Lake of Vouliagmeni.

2
Stop 2

You will admire the view of Vouliagmeni Lake, the geological phenomenon which is considered as a Site of Outstanding Natural Beauty by the Ministry of Culture. The lake is included in Greece’s national NATURA 2000 network. We ll stay there for almost 20min. for you to also take great photos. It will take us almost another 20min, until we reach our next destination, the Temple of Poseidon in Cape Sounion.

3
Stop 3

You will be amazed by the magic in the air of your final destination, the Temple of Poseidon. Poseidon was the God of the Sea and Athenians used to choose temple locations that were physically related to or suggestive of the deity honored in the temples. The view of the Aegean Sea from the Temple is breathtaking. Grab the chance to take photos you will gaze for a lifetime. We will stay there for about 1 1/2 hour and it will take us almost 10min. to reach our last point of interest, Thoricus.

4

You will admire the oldest theater in existence and be surprised to visit the first industrial area that dates to 3500 years ago. We will stay in this site for about half an hour and we ll drive back to the drop off point, which will take us almost 80min. more.

About Athens

Athens, the capital of Greece, is a city rich in history and culture, often considered the cradle of Western civilization. It is home to iconic ancient landmarks, vibrant neighborhoods, and a thriving modern scene.

Best Time to Visit

April to June, September to October

The best time to visit Athens is during the spring and autumn months when the weather is pleasant and the tourist crowds are smaller.

Day trips

Cape Sounion
65 km from Athens • Half day to full day

A scenic coastal area featuring the Temple of Poseidon with stunning views of the Aegean Sea.

Delphi
180 km from Athens • Full day

An ancient archaeological site and home to the famous Oracle of Delphi.

Meteora
350 km from Athens • Overnight

A unique landscape featuring rock formations and medieval monasteries perched atop cliffs.
